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
658608425 237 72166
0841447675 1605979140
0841447675 1605979140
529769496 749224424 1866951 178647222
All about undefined
Interested in learning more?
0841447675 1605979140
529769496 749224424 1866951 178647222
See more
680 2535 886
239 288 879756
See more
47438901 967 822343241
38790528769 2785 0361270
See more